Abstract:
Method (M1) for determining radiation curing conditions for a coating material comprising a pigment, a binder and a photoinitiator comprises determining the integral transmission (T) of a pigment composition in a desired wavelength range and determining the variables required for radiation curing from T. Method (M1) for determining radiation curing conditions for a coating material comprising a pigment, a binder and a photoinitiator comprises providing a pigment composition or establishing the pigment composition necessary to achieve a desired color; measuring the reflectance spectrum of the pigment in the composition as a function of concentration, composition and/or film thickness; determining the concentration-specific absorption and scattering spectra (A and S) of the pigment from the measured reflectance spectrum in a desired wavelength range; measuring the reflectance (R) of a substrate in the desired spectral range; determining total absorption and total scattering values from the coating material on the substrate from A, S and R; determining the integral transmission (T) of the pigment composition in the desired wavelength range; and determining the variables required for radiation curing from T. Independent claims are also included for: (1) method (M2) for radiation curing a coating material as above on the basis of variables determined by M1; (2) apparatus for performing M2, comprising an irradiation unit, a computer and optionally a measuring unit, where the computer determines the required curing data by M1 and the irradiation unit performs the curing operation on the basis of the data; (3) business method for radiation curing in which a supplier provides a user with a program for performing M2 with an associated database comprising A and S data for pigments and substrates, or with data established with such a program, and the user performs a radiation curing operation on the basis of the data.
